2026年3月,人工智能编程助手领域迎来了一个里程碑事件:Anthropic的Claude Code被证实贡献了GitHub上大约4%的公开提交代码。这个数据并非四舍五入的误差,而是由SemiAnalysis追踪并得到Anthropic默认的真实数字,意味着全球每25行开源代码中,就有一行是由一家公司旗下的AI编程agent完成的。这一惊人发现彻底改变了AI编程的讨论重心,将问题从“我该尝试哪个工具?”转向了“哪个工具已经在悄无声息地编写你大部分的代码栈?”
目前,该领域主要有三大玩家:Cursor、Claude Code和OpenAI Codex。它们曾是截然不同的产品形态——一个编辑器、一个命令行Agent和一个云沙盒。但在2026年4月的第一周,它们开始融合。OpenAI推出了一个官方的Codex插件,可以直接在Claude Code内部运行;Cursor也重建了其Agent编排UI以适应这一趋势。这场三方竞争已演变为一个“三层技术栈”,选择错误的层级可能每天都会让你损失数小时。
真正重要的衡量指标
抛开市场宣传,以下是一些我们真正值得信赖的采用信号:
- Claude Code — 工程师首选: 《The Pragmatic Engineer》在2026年2月对906名专业工程师的调查显示,Claude Code在“我愿意为之奋斗以保留的工具”中排名第一,获得了46%的支持率。其他任何编程Agent的得票率均未超过25%。
- Claude Code — GitHub提交占比: SemiAnalysis的提交作者追踪器发现,Claude Code通过其一致的差异模式和提交消息节奏等特征,在3月份的GitHub公开提交中贡献了4%。他们预测到2026年12月,这一比例将达到20%。
- Codex — 每周活跃用户: OpenAI在2026年4月的开发者日演讲中展示,Codex的每周活跃用户达到300万,比一个月前的200万增长了50%。这是在该类别最大用户基数上实现的惊人月度增长。
- Cursor — 默认IDE地位: Cursor自2025年末以来未发布新的使用数据,这种沉默本身就是一种信号。该公司在4月第一周重建了其Agent编排UI,这明确表明它正在努力保持竞争力,因为Agent工作流正在逐渐侵蚀传统编辑器的地位。
如果你只记住一句话:Claude Code赢得了工程师的心,Codex拥有惊人的吞吐量,而Cursor则占据了用户的肌肉记忆。
Claude Code:能力之王
Claude Code是一款以CLI(命令行界面)为优先的Agent,它在你的终端中运行,并直接编辑你代码仓库中的文件。它没有IDE插件,也没有云沙盒——它存在于你的代码所在之处。
它真正擅长以下几点:
- 规划能力: Claude Code在修改文件之前会起草一个多步骤的计划。你批准后,它才会执行。这是《The Pragmatic Engineer》受访者选择它的最主要原因——这个计划使得Agent的工作可审计。
- 长周期任务: 在我上周进行的一个真实重构任务中——将一个包含47个文件的Next.js应用从Pages Router迁移到App Router——Claude Code在42分钟内完成,仅回滚了两次。Codex在同一任务上失败了两次,因为它耗尽了沙盒时间。
- MCP集成: Claude Code是Anthropic Model Context Pr的参考实现,这表明其与Anthropic模型上下文管理能力深度融合。